I say wait until you get there. When you go to MCO on the Beach Line ( hwy 528), you have MANY good choices if you go north on Semoran Blvd. (the airport is south). Either fast food restaurants or table service.

Within a mile of the airport entrance, on Semoran, you have Denny’s, Tony Roma’s, Sonny’s BBQ, Hooters, Chili’s, and many more. I would wait till you get in the terminal. The airport has many fast food places not any worse than the restaurants above.
